Management Meeting Minutes — Branch Managers, Drossel Appliances

Main topic: warranty costs on the Helvane dryer line ran 40% over plan last quarter, mostly drum-bearing failures. Engineering has a fix shipping from the Marwick plant in six weeks. Branches should keep logging claims as usual. Lena walked us through the financial impact and next steps, summarized below.

board note of fafog-yahap: Project Rusdor slips by a full year because of the audit delay.

Runbook: Vantrel session-token refresh failures

Symptom: users bounced to login mid-session. Cause: refresh endpoint returns a new token but the Aldergate proxy caches the old one for up to 60s.

Steps:
1. Confirm spike on the auth-refresh-fail dashboard.
2. Flush the Aldergate token cache via the admin console.
3. Verify a fresh login survives two refresh cycles.
4. If failures persist, roll back the proxy to the last known-good build.

Escalate to on-call auth if step 3 fails twice. Known-good build token below.

trace token, kahog-tajeg: htk6_97d963

Dependency pinning for the Larkspan build system: all direct dependencies must be pinned to exact versions; transitive pins are generated weekly by the lockfile refresh job. Reviewers should reject any change that introduces a range specifier or removes a pin without a linked upgrade ticket. Security patches may bypass the weekly cycle but still require exact pins. If the refresh job fails, rerun it locally before approving anything. The job reads its pinning rules from the configuration that follows.

deployment values, yajep-kajop:
[praael]
host = praael.tolvaqworks.corp
user = praael_svc
database = praael_prod

## Configuration: Export Retries

As discussed at the weekly eng sync, Pellwright's export worker now retries failed batch exports up to five times with exponential backoff. Set EXPORT_RETRY_LIMIT and EXPORT_BACKOFF_MS in your .env before deploying. The retry queue also authenticates against the Garvane archive service, so add the following line to your .env file:

sealed setting: ARCHIVE_KEY3=8d0